What is declarative net request?

declarativeNetRequest API is used to block or modify network requests by specifying declarative rules. This lets extensions modify network requests without intercepting them and viewing their content, thus providing more privacy.

How do I automatically redirect a URL in HTML?

The simplest way to redirect to another URL is to use an HTML <meta> tag with the http-equiv parameter set to “refresh”. The content attribute sets the delay before the browser redirects the user to the new web page. To redirect immediately, set this parameter to “0” seconds for the content attribute.

What are declarative methods?

Meaning. A declarative method is a paradigm of programming in which the desired result, the WHAT is 'declared', is specified. In contrast, the imperative method is based on the specification of concrete sequences of commands that the system must pass through to achieve the desired result.

What browser can bypass blocked sites?

5. Use the Tor Browser to unblock banned sites. The Tor Browser is a free open-source internet anonymity tool created as a response to online censorship. By sending your data through a network of volunteer servers, it hides your IP from the destination server and hides the destination server IP from your ISP.

How do I permanently redirect a URL?

To redirect a site permanently, one should use a 301 redirect. This type of redirect is best for SEO purposes and also informs the search engines that the site has moved permanently. If you change your domain name and want to point to a different URL, a 301 redirect is your best choice.

How do I enable url redirects?

On the taskbar, click Start, and then click Control Panel. In Control Panel, click Programs and Features, and then click Turn Windows Features on or off. Expand Internet Information Services, then World Wide Web Services, then Common Http Features. Select HTTP Redirection, and then click OK.

What is redirect URL in API?

A redirect URI, or reply URL, is the location where the authorization server sends the user once the app has been successfully authorized and granted an authorization code or access token.

What causes URL redirection?

Web pages may be redirected to a new domain for three reasons: a site might desire, or need, to change its domain name; an author might move their individual pages to a new domain; two web sites might merge.
